Abstract

The utility model discloses a special filter assembly for an assembled dust removing device, which comprises a filter cartridge main body arranged at the inner side of a dust remover body, wherein two base plates are fixed at the inner side of the dust remover body, and the filter cartridge main body is arranged between the two base plates, so that the filter cartridge main body is stably supported after being arranged, and end seats are fixed at the upper end and the lower end of the filter cartridge main body; a dismounting mechanism is arranged between the end seat and the substrate; through the arranged disassembling and assembling mechanism, the dust removal filter cylinder can be quickly installed between the two base plates, stable and quick assembly is realized, the assembly efficiency and later-stage disassembling and assembling convenience are greatly improved, and convenience is brought to follow-up operators for disassembling, cleaning and replacing the dust removal filter cylinder; through the pressing plate and the limit support block and other structures, after the pressing rod is pressed by an operator, the pressing plate can be rotated to one side of the limit support block, the pressing rod is prevented from rebounding, and the convenience of actual dismounting between the end seat and the base plate is further guaranteed.

Examples
Referring to fig. 1 to 5, the present invention provides a technical solution: a special filter component for assembled dust removing equipment comprises a filter cylinder main body 1 arranged on the inner side of a dust remover machine body 4, two base plates 5 are fixed on the inner side of the dust remover machine body 4, the filter cylinder main body 1 is arranged between the two base plates 5, and end seats 2 are fixed at the upper end and the lower end of the filter cylinder main body 1;
a dismounting mechanism is arranged between the end seat 2 and the base plate 5, the dismounting mechanism comprises a side seat 6, a movable column 7, a rectangular groove 8, a side clamping block 13, a side clamping groove 14 and a pressing rod 9, the side seat 6 is welded and fixed on the two side surfaces of the end seat 2, the movable column 7 is movably arranged on the top surface of the side seat 6, the side clamping block 13 is welded and fixed on the end part of the movable column 7, the rectangular groove 8 corresponding to the movable column 7 is arranged on one side surface of the base plate 5 and used for pushing the movable column 7, the side clamping groove 14 corresponding to the side clamping block 13 is arranged on one side inner wall of the rectangular groove 8 and used for clamping the side clamping block 13, the front end of the side clamping block 13 is communicated with the front surface of the base plate 5, the end part of the movable column 7 is embedded into the inner side of the rectangular groove 8, the side clamping block 13 is embedded into the side clamping groove 14, the movable groove 15 is arranged in the side seat 6, and the stable connection of the end seat 2 and the base plate 5 can be realized, and a movable block 16 is movably arranged in the movable groove 15, a pressing rod 9 is rotatably arranged on one side of the movable block 16, the end part of the pressing rod 9 penetrates through one side of the side seat 6, an operator can push the movable block 16 through the pressing rod 9 conveniently, a top connecting block 18 is fixedly welded on the top of the movable block 16, a connecting slide way corresponding to the top connecting block 18 is arranged on the inner wall of one side of the movable groove 15 and communicated with the surface of the side seat 6, the top connecting block 18 is movably arranged in the connecting slide way, the end part of the top connecting block 18 extends out of the surface of the side seat 6 and is fixed with the movable column 7, so that the movable block 16 can drive the movable column 7 to move, a spring 17 is further arranged on the other side of the movable block 16, and the end part of the spring 17 abuts against the inner wall of the movable groove 15, so that the movable block 16 can rebound and reset under the pushing of the spring 17 after being pressed.
In this embodiment, preferably, a pressing plate 10 is fixed to one side of the end of the pressing rod 9 opposite to the side seat 6 in a welding manner, so as to facilitate pressing of the pressing rod 9, a limiting support block 11 corresponding to the pressing plate 10 is fixed to the surface of the end seat 2, so that an operator can rotate the pressing rod 9 to one side of the limiting support block 11 after pressing, springback of the pressing rod 9 is prevented, convenience in actual disassembly and assembly is further ensured, a rotating block with a T-shaped cross section is fixed to one side of the movable block 16, the pressing rod 9 is rotatably sleeved on the rotating block, and is used for smooth rotation of the pressing rod 9, a sealing ring 12 is installed on the end surface of the end seat 2 in a gluing manner, the sealing ring 12 is a rubber component, a sealing groove corresponding to the sealing ring 12 is formed in the surface of one side of the substrate 5, the end of the sealing ring 12 is embedded into the sealing groove, and the sealing performance between the end seat 2 and the substrate 5 is improved.

In this embodiment, preferably, a side hole communicated with the movable groove 15 is formed on the end surface of the side seat 6, and the side hole corresponds to the pressing rod 9 for smooth penetration of the pressing rod 9.
The utility model discloses a theory of operation and use flow: when the dust removal filter cartridge is assembled, the pressure plate 10 and the pressing rod 9 are firstly rotated by one hundred eighty degrees upwards to prevent the pressure plate 10 from being blocked by the limit support block 11, the pressure plate 10 and the pressing rod 9 are pressed to cause the movable block 16 to compress the spring 17 and cause the top connecting block 18 to drive the movable column 7 to displace until the pressure plate 10 can be pressed to the other side of the limit support block 11, the pressure plate 10 and the pressing rod 9 are rotated by one hundred eighty degrees downwards to cause the end part of the pressure plate 10 to be lapped on the other side of the limit support block 11, so that the pressure plate 10 and the pressing rod 9 can be supported to prevent rebounding, then the rest pressure plate 10 and the rest pressing rod 9 are operated in the same way, after the pressing limit operation of all the pressure plate 10 and the pressing rod 9 is completed, the filter cartridge body 1 can be pushed into the two base plates 5 to cause the movable column 7 and the side clamping block 13 to be pushed into the rectangular groove 8, two end seats 2 can be respectively attached to two base plates 5, a sealing ring 12 is embedded into a sealing groove, the dust-removing filter cylinder is smoothly pushed in, at the moment, a pressing plate 10 rotates by one hundred eighty degrees, so that the pressing plate 10 is not blocked by a limiting supporting block 11, then the pressing plate 10 and a pressing rod 9 are loosened, a spring 17 pushes a movable block 16 back, a top connecting block 18 drives a movable column 7 and a side clamping block 13 to rebound, the side clamping block 13 is clamped into a side clamping groove 14, stable limiting on the end seats 2 can be realized, stable installation of the dust-removing filter cylinder is realized, then the pressing plate 10 rotates by one hundred eighty degrees, so that the end part of the pressing plate 10 can be positioned on one side of the limiting supporting block 11, the pressing plate 10 is blocked by the limiting supporting block 11, the pressing plate 10 and the pressing rod 9 are prevented from being pressed by mistake during daily use, and finally a protection ring 3 is rotated and screwed on the surface of the end seat 2, until the guard ring 3 is tightly attached to the base plate 5, the whole cover of the dismounting mechanism can be protected on the inner side through the guard ring 3, the installation stability of the dust removal filter cylinder is ensured, and subsequently, if the dust removal filter cylinder needs to be dismounted for cleaning and replacement, the guard ring 3 only needs to be turned round firstly, the dismounting mechanism is exposed, the pressing plate 10 is rotated and the pressing rod 9 is pressed down, so that the side clamping block 13 is moved out of the side clamping groove 14, then the pressing plate 10 is turned round, the pressing plate 10 is lapped on the surface of the limiting supporting block 11 to prevent the pressing rod 9 and the movable column 7 from rebounding, then the same operation is carried out on the rest pressing plate 10 and the pressing rod 9, the limitation on the end seat 2 can be removed, the dust removal filter cylinder is directly dismounted from the two base plates 5, and the dust removal filter cylinder is rapidly dismounted.
